Development Engineer Electrical Engineering | Entwicklungsingenieur Elektrotechnik (m/w/d)
FERCHAU GmbH Niederlassung Berlin Süd
Job Summary
This role is for an ambitious Development Engineer specializing in Electrical Engineering, focusing on connecting people and technologies to deliver complex development projects for high-profile clients in electrical and automation technology sectors. Day-to-day responsibilities include conceptualizing new plant technology, translating customer requirements into tailored solutions, evaluating and procuring technical components, and providing expert technical support during construction and manufacturing phases. The ideal candidate possesses a degree in Electrical Engineering, professional experience, and specific knowledge in high-frequency technology, ideally plasma technology, along with experience in automation technology. Success in this position requires strong analytical skills, a pragmatic, solution-oriented approach, and the ability to act as the crucial interface between the client and the development team. The position offers an unlimited employment contract and opportunities for professional development.
